Middle East Airlines partners with HP & MDS to boost business operations
MEA has implemented HP’s datacenter solutions to optimize on existing business processes and offer better customer services.
September 13, 2010 3:22 by Rasha Reslan
Dubai, UAE, September 12 2010- HP Middle East today announced that Middle East Airlines (MEA), Lebanon’s national carrier, has signed an agreement that will help add new capabilities and value to MEA’s business operations in the region.
As per the agreement, MEA has implemented HP’s datacenter solutions to optimize on existing business processes and offer better customer services.
HP Proliant Blade Enclosures, in addition to storage and networking solutions, have been deployed at the airline’s main site in Beirut.
Prior to the implementation some of the challenges such as limitations in deploying new technologies like virtualization, performance issues, the mounting total cost of ownership of obsolete equipments, in addition to growing storage capacity needs and application sprawls, was starting to weigh down on the airline’s service level agreement (SLA).
Through the new virtualized infrastructure MEA aims to cut power consumption, contain costs and optimize on new business opportunities. Thanks to the HP solutions, MEA will be able to serve their customers better and faster, saving costs in data center maintenance.

The implementation which went live last month was carried out by Midware Data Systems, a leading provider of advanced IT Infrastructure solutions in Lebanon. “We are committed to helping organizations advance their business processes and services through HP’s broad product portfolio. Our focus has been and remains on delivering HP’s core values to our customers in Lebanon, helping them achieve outstanding business results.” said George Geha, President, Midware Data Systems
As the world’s leading transportation IT services provider, HP processes more than 42 million airline reservations each month and more than 500 million per year. HP’s comprehensive portfolio of world-class technology solutions encompasses air carriers, airports, cruise lines, hotel companies, major reservations networks, logistics and modal providers.
